Spicy Sweet Potato Fries with Cilantro Ranch Sauce

Sweet and spicy sweet potato fries are perfectly crispy and go incredibly well with a creamy cilantro ranch sauce for dipping.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Soaking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 50 minutes
Servings 3 servings
Calories 323kcal

Ingredients

Cilantro Ranch Sauce

  • 1/4 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 tablespoons Greek y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on buttermilk
  • 2 teaspoons lime juice
  • 1/4 cup firmly-packed cilantro
  • 1 medium clove gar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Sweet Potato Fries

  • 2 medium sweet potatoes, cut into 1/4-inch wide x 3-inch long strips (you can peel them if you like, I like to leave the skin on)
  • 2 tablespoons melted coconut oil
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

Cilantro Ranch Sauce

  • Place all sauce ingredients in a food processor or blender. Blend on high speed until smooth and season with salt and pepper to taste. Store dip in refrigerator until ready to serve.

Sweet Potato Fries

  • Place sweet potato strips in a large bowl and cover with water. Allow to soak 1 hour.
  • Preheat oven to 425F and lightly grease a large sheet pan. Drain sweet potatoes and pat completely dry with paper towels. Transfer to a large bowl.
  • Add coconut oil, cornstarch, garlic powder, onion powder, cayenne, paprika, and salt and pepper to taste to sweet potatoes and toss well until evenly coated.
  • Arrange sweet potatoes in a single layer on prepared sheet pan, spacing fries apart as much as possible. Bake fries at 425F 25-30 minutes, flipping once halfway through baking, until fries are crispy.
  • Serve sweet potato fries immediately while warm with cilantro dip. Enjoy!
